20 April - Chinese Language Day


 

Chinese Language Day is celebrated on April 20th each year. It was established by the United Nations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ization (UNESCO) to promote multilingualism and cultural diversity.

April 20th was chosen as Chinese Language Day to coincide with the date when Cangjie, a mythical figure in ancient China, is traditionally believed to have invented Chinese characters. The Chinese writing system, with its rich history and complexity, is one of the oldest writing systems still in use today.

Chinese Language Day aims to celebrate the beauty and cultural significance of the Chinese language, as well as to raise awareness about the importance of linguistic diversity and language learning. It provides an opportunity for people around the world to explore and appreciate the Chinese language and its contributions to human civilization.
